Faulty Deadbolt

A deadbolt that is broken can cause your door lock to become extremely difficult to turn, or to remain in its locked position. A broken deadbolt can make it easier for burglars to gain entry into your home. There are a variety of reasons your deadbolt could be damaged. One possibility is that the deadbolt is worn out. This is because as time goes on things tend to get looser, especially when you use doors often. Another reason is that there may be a problem with the mechanism itself, which will need a locksmith to fix.

Misalignment can also cause a deadbolt to malfunction. This happens when the frame of the front door is slightly distorted, and the deadbolts and handles are no longer able to fit into the frame. This can occur from water damage as well as structural settling and improper installation.

Another possibility with your deadbolt is that it might have damaged cylinder. You can test this by observing the length of the bolt when you turn it. If it's not long enough then you will need to have a locksmith replace the lock cylinder.

If you have a spare key you can use to test the deadbolt then you should try this first. This will help you to see whether the issue is related to the lock or something else, such as the key being cut badly.

If you are able to open and close your deadbolt by using keys and it is not working, then the issue is likely to be related to the door's frame or that the lock was put in place incorrectly. This can be corrected by a bit of gentle jiggling and tapping with the Hammer. It's recommended to leave this work to the professionals though because it could lead to further damage to the lock or your door.

Cylinder is faulty Cylinder

The cylinder is the heart of locks. It controls its locking and unlocking function. They are available in a variety of lock styles, including deadbolts lever handle locks, lever handle locks, and mortice door French door lock repair near me and window locks. They are so adaptable, a locksmith can create them in a variety of materials and with different levels of security. They are able to be interchangeable, allowing the use of multiple locks with a single key.

The lock cylinder is generally made from brass or steel, which helps to protect it from attack. Most often, it's coated with a special anti-corrosion finish to prevent it from rusting and protect it against weather damage. The cylinders also come in various sizes and grades that will meet the requirements of your door as well as the level of security. Some have been tested for attack and certified, meaning that they are incredibly difficult to break or pick.

Repair-Engineer-small.pngIf you notice that your keys go into the cylinder with a euro profile and turn, but they aren't able to open the door or the window, it's a sign that the multipoint lock is malfunctioning or the rubber seal on the door or window has moved & stopped it being properly seated. A locksmith who has been certified can change the lock cylinder, provide new keys and offer advice on the future maintenance.
